Wyoming Statutes
§ 14-2-906 — Effect of dissolution of marriage or withdrawal of consent
(a)If a marriage is dissolved before placement of eggs,
sperm or embryos, the former spouse is not a parent of the
resulting child unless the former spouse consented in a record
that if assisted reproduction were to occur after a divorce, the
former spouse would be a parent of the child.
(b)The consent of a woman or a man to assisted
reproduction may be withdrawn by that individual in a record at
any time before placement of eggs, sperm or embryos. An
individual who withdraws consent under this section is not a
parent of the resulting child.
